Antiquities Commission; Foundation; Historical Records Advisory Board; Historic Sites Board of Review; Law Enforcement Memorial; State Records … WebYou should ask the following questions in order to establish the foundation for a letter to be admitted into evidence: Are you familiar with the signature of Mr. Smith (person who signed letter)? How are you familiar with Mr. Smith's signature? Show the witness plaintiff's Exhibit "D" for identification.
WebMar 5, 2024 · Pa.R.E. 901. This includes testimony by a witness with personal knowledge, which may be sufficient to authenticate or identify the evidence. Commonwealth v. Hudson, 414 A.2d 1381 (Pa. 1980) citing Pa.R.E. 901 (b) (1). The authentication requirement can also be waived by stipulation or by failure to object in a timely manner.
